Local Time Frame
You have a limited window to file a personal injury claim Georgia lawsuit—just two years from the date of injury under Georgia law. Missing this deadline typically eliminates your right to sue entirely. Exceptions exist for minors, incapacitated individuals, or hit and run accident cases. Pain and Suffering Award
Emotional trauma compensation accounts for the non-economic toll of your trauma. Unlike medical bills or lost wages, these damages aren’t itemized but are calculated using multipliers or per-diem methods. Factors like recovery time, scarring, PTSD, or permanent limitations increase the value.
